  2. !*!Fact File!*! • Capital: Dhaka • Population: 144,319,628 (2005) • Location: Southern Asia, bordering the bay of Bengal, between Burma and India • Currency: Taka (BDT) • Climate: Tropical in mild winter (October to March) • Hot and humid in Summer (March to June) • Humid with a warm and rainy monsoon (June to October) • Religions: Muslim (83%) and Hindu (16%) then other is only 1% • Ethnic groups: Bengali (98%), tribal groups. Non Bengali Muslims

  3. !*!About the Language!*! The official language is Bangla, which is also known as Bengali. It is the first language of more than 98% of the population. Many people that live in Bangladesh also speak English and Urdu. Hello: Nomoskaar Goodbye: Bidai Sir: Bahadur Madam: Begum
